U2's eighth studio album Zooropa emerged in the middle of the Zoo TV Tour, transforming from a planned EP into a fully realized album recorded in just six weeks. Produced by Flood, Brian Eno, and the Edge, it was released on July 5, 1993, on Island Records, inspired by the band's experiences on the Zoo TV Tour and expanding on themes of technology and media oversaturation. Originally intended as an EP to promote the "Zooropa" leg of the tour, during the sessions the group decided to extend the record to a full-length album. The Edge received his first production credit on a U2 record for the extra level of responsibility he assumed. The album topped charts in 17 countries and won the Grammy Award for Best Alternative Music Album, though it remains one of U2's most underrated releases. The title track "Zooropa" opens with atmospheric electronica before building to a declaration of European identity. "Numb" features the Edge on lead vocals, while "Lemon" showcases the band's embrace of electronic dance music. "Stay (Faraway, So Close!)" became the album's most successful single, reaching the top five in multiple countries. "Babyface" and "Daddy's Gonna Pay For Your Crashed Car" demonstrate U2's experimental edge with sampling and unconventional structures. "Some Days Are Better Than Others" and "The First Time" offer introspective moments, while "Dirty Day" explores father-son relationships with raw emotion. The closer "The Wanderer" features Johnny Cash on vocals, creating a haunting meditation on spiritual searching.
